A recent online discussion has sparked intense debate regarding billionaires' investment strategies in cryptocurrency. As critics deride those advocating so-called shitcoins, deeper concerns about wealth and market manipulation emerge, fueling fervent commentary within crypto forums.

Context of the Controversy

The assertion that billionaires might willingly exchange significant portions of their wealth for obscure cryptocurrencies has been met with skepticism. While one user claimed, "Actually, the billionaires are selling their Bitcoin to people like this," others expressed doubts about the rationality of such moves.

Themes from the Discussion

  1. Value Perception

    Many commenters highlighted a fundamental misunderstanding of cryptocurrency's practicality. One noted, "They don't get how that hyper deflation is just as annoying as hyper inflation," stressing that both extremes complicate financial stability.

  2. Skepticism of Influencers

    The authenticity of financial advice from influencers is another hot topic. A commenter pointed out: "There are a lot of bots out there," suggesting a lack of genuine insights cloud the discussion, indicating pervasive trust issues.

  3. Wealth Redistribution

    Views diverged on wealth transfer potentialโ€”some fantasized about billionaires trading their luxuries for worthless coins. A notable remark stated, "Makes total sense. Fiat currency wonโ€™t have any value," exemplifying a disconnect between wealth perception and reality.

Forum Sentiment

The overall sentiment appears decidedly negative, dominated by skepticism. Users challenge each otherโ€™s perspectives while also critiquing the credibility of crypto influencers and the logic behind capital investments in volatile markets.

"Iโ€™ll bet you any amount of money that any answer this plonker gives will be bullshit," one commenter quipped, showcasing the boiling frustration of participants.

A Historical Perspective Worth Considering

Drawing a line to the past, the dot-com bubble of the late 1990s serves as a unique parallel. Much like today's obsession with cryptocurrencies, investors poured vast sums into obscure tech startups with little substance. Many saw unproven ideas as the future, only to face heartbreak when the bubble burst. This reflects how the excitement around innovation can blind people to foundational value, reminding us that today's enthusiasm might mirror a similar cycle of rapid rise and painful correction when reality sets back in.
